Freshman Kyre Allison scored 26 points at Logan on Feb.15, 2013, which tied Andrew Bendolph's 26 point effort as a freshman vs. Chillicothe in 2008. The 26 points is believed to be the highest point total for a Trojan freshman in school history. I have not discovered any higher totals to date. The 6-1 Allison also tallied games of 24 and 20 points late in the regular season, and led the Trojans with 17 points in the sectional championship game vs. Wheelersburg.
